How to Choose the Ideal Private Driver Service for Your Tour?
The quality of services varies considerably across different providers. Therefore, when selecting a service, it is crucial to focus on several key criteria.
- The qualifications of the driver-guide are the first essential factor. The best professionals possess a dual expertise: flawless driving skills and extensive knowledge of Parisian history, architecture, and culture.
- Language skills are another fundamental aspect. Ensure that the guide speaks your language fluently for seamless communication and nuanced explanations.
- The quality of the vehicle greatly influences your comfort during the tour. Check the model offered, its year of circulation, and its luxury level. Recent German sedans (Mercedes E-Class, BMW 5 Series, Audi A6) or French models (DS7) are the industry standard for small groups of up to three people. For larger groups, Mercedes V-Class or Volkswagen Caravelle vans provide optimal comfort and visibility.
- The reputation of the service provider is also a reliable indicator of quality. Check customer reviews on independent platforms like TripAdvisor, Google Reviews, or Trustpilot.
Must-See Sites and Recommended Itineraries
A Paris City Tour with a private driver allows you to explore the capital according to your preferences, but certain sites are absolute must-sees to capture the essence of Paris.
Classic 4-Hour Tour
For a first-time visit, the classic 4-hour itinerary takes you through the city’s most famous landmarks. The tour usually starts at the Eiffel Tower, with a stop at Trocadéro to enjoy the panoramic view.
Your driver will then take you to the Champs-Élysées, passing over the Pont Alexandre III, considered Paris’s most elegant bridge. Traveling up “the most beautiful avenue in the world” leads to the Arc de Triomphe, before continuing to the Place de la Concorde with its Egyptian obelisk.
The tour proceeds with an exterior visit to the Louvre Museum and its iconic glass pyramid, followed by a stop at Île de la Cité, home to Notre-Dame Cathedral (viewed from the outside during its reconstruction). A quick visit to the Latin Quarter and Saint-Germain-des-Prés rounds off this introductory tour of Paris.
Full-Day Tour (8 Hours)
For a full-day tour (8 hours), additional sites enrich the itinerary.
- Montmartre and its Sacré-Cœur Basilica offer a unique view over the city and a charming village atmosphere.
- Le Marais reveals its historic mansions, Place des Vosges, and a vibrant yet historic ambiance.
- To finish, a deeper dive into the Opéra Garnier will allow you to admire this Second Empire architectural masterpiece.
